Abstract: The reaction between RuCl(PPh3)2Cp* and {Cu(CCPh)}n in refluxing benzene afforded Ru2Cu2(C2Ph)5H2(Cl)(PPh3)Cp*2, which contains an unusual tetramer of the phenylethynyl group which interacts with an Ru…Cu…Cu…Ru chain. The second Ru atom is part of a ruthenocenyl moiety which interacts weakly with the second Cu atom, and bears a vinylidene which bridges an Ru–Cu vector. The structure of a second modification of Ru(Ctriple bond; length of mdashCPh)(CO)(PPh3)Cp* is also reported
